The Appeal of a High RTP
The 98% Return to Player (RTP) is a significant selling point for the chicken road crossing game, setting it apart from many other casual gaming experiences. RTP essentially represents the percentage of all wagered money that is, on average, returned to players over the long term. A 98% RTP means that for every $100 wagered, the game is designed to pay out $98 back to players, with the remaining $2 representing the house edge. This high RTP indicates a favorable chance of winning back your wager and accumulating profits, making the game more attractive to players who appreciate favorable odds.
It’s important to note, however, that RTP is a theoretical calculation based on long-term play. Individual gaming sessions will vary, and there’s always an element of luck involved. While the 98% RTP suggests a relatively low house edge, it does not guarantee that every player will win every time. However, over a sustained period, a high RTP like this indicates that it’s a game that rewards consistent play and strategic decision-making, making skillful gameplay all the more vital.
